WebIntroduction. Familial adenomatous polyposis (FAP) is an inherited, highly penetrant genetic condition predisposing to an almost 100% colorectal cancer risk. 1 Since FAP can be fatal if left untreated, early detection and diagnosis in gene carriers and at-risk individuals is vital. WebAFAP is not well-defined as a disease entity - the reports on AFAP are largely casuistic or only deal with a few kindreds--and the diagnostic criteria and methods of investigation differ markedly. The true incidence and frequency of AFAP is not known.

WebPeople affected by FAP also have a risk of developing cancer in the stomach or small bowel. The risk is much lower than for bowel cancer.
